Typo3 如何在流体模板表单元素中输出COA_INT

Typo3 如何在流体模板表单元素中输出COA_INT,typo3,fluid,extbase,typo3-8.x,typo3-9.x,Typo3,Fluid,Extbase,Typo3 8.x,Typo3 9.x,我想将一个扩展GP变量传递给在插件外部构建的表单。当尝试这样做时,我使用了一个COA_INT,结果输出 并且还尝试在使用f:variable之前构建变量,但没有任何效果 预期的结果是,将设置变量,然后将值传递给form.textfield viewhelper,但显然这也不起作用。您应该在Typoscript(设置)中提交变量,包括: page.10=FLUIDTEMPLATE page.10.variables.gpsbrow

我想将一个扩展GP变量传递给在插件外部构建的表单。当尝试这样做时,我使用了一个COA_INT,结果输出

并且还尝试在使用
f:variable
之前构建变量,但没有任何效果


预期的结果是,将设置变量,然后将值传递给form.textfield viewhelper,但显然这也不起作用。

您应该在Typoscript(设置)中提交变量,包括:

page.10=FLUIDTEMPLATE
page.10.variables.gpsbrow
然后,您就可以在Fluidtemplate中使用它:

<f:format.raw>{gpSWord}</f:format.raw>
{gpsbrow}

您应该在打字脚本(设置)中提交变量,包括:

page.10=FLUIDTEMPLATE
page.10.variables.gpsbrow
然后,您就可以在Fluidtemplate中使用它:

<f:format.raw>{gpSWord}</f:format.raw>
{gpsbrow}
试试这个


对GP试试这个。

这和ading
{f:cObject(typoscriptObjectPath:'lib.GP剑术')}
不一样吗?我总是使用我推荐的方法,而且效果很好。我在Fluidtemplate中也使用了这个:这同样有效。但是我推荐我的答案中的一个,因为它更清楚。这不是和ading
{f:cObject(typoscriptObjectPath:'lib.gp剑术')}
一样吗?我总是使用我推荐的方式,它就像一个符咒。我在Fluidtemplate中也使用了这个:这同样有效。但我推荐我答案中的那个,因为它更清楚。
page.10 = FLUIDTEMPLATE
page.10.variables.gpSWord < lib.gpSWord
<f:format.raw>{gpSWord}</f:format.raw>
lib.gpSWord = COA_INT
lib.gpSWord {    
  stdWrap {
      wrap = &tx_indexedsearch_pi2[sword]=|
      data = GP:tx_indexedsearch_pi2|sword
      if.isTrue.data = GP:tx_indexedsearch_pi2|sword
    }
}